The majestic Victoria Sponge. A cake popularised in Queen Victoria's reign and is still a classic today. Why not whip up this much-loved classic at home to kick off the Jubilee celebrations and put a smile on your face this March. Believed to be one of the favourites enjoyed by the Queen as part of her Afternoon Tea, this royal cake always delivers on flavour and simplicity.
